症状
请考虑以下情况:
-
您的实体在 Microsoft SQL Server 2012 Master Data Services (MDS)中具有四个属性。 例如,实体的属性为 A1、A2、A3 和 F。属性 A3 是基于域的属性。
-
您有两个业务规则。 一个规则尝试将 F 的值设置为 A1。 当 A3 设置为某个值时,第二条规则尝试将 F 的值设置为 A2。
-
发布和应用两个业务规则。
在这种情况下,不会更新 F 的值。注意预期运算是属性 A3 指示 F 将更新为 A2 的值。 而 F 的值将保持空白。
解决方案
累积更新信息
SQL Server 2012 的累积更新 2 Service Pack 1 (SP1)
此问题的修补程序首次在累积更新2中发布。有关如何获取此累积更新包的 SQL Server 2012 Service Pack 1 的详细信息,请单击下面的文章编号,以查看 Microsoft 知识库中相应的文章:
2790947 SQL Server 2012 的累积更新包 2 Service Pack 1注意 由于这些版本是累积的,因此每个新的修复版本都包含以前的 SQL Server 2012 Service Pack 1 修复版本附带的所有修补程序和所有安全修补程序。 我们建议你考虑应用包含此修补程序的最新修复版本。 有关更多信息,请单击下面的文章编号,以查看 Microsoft 知识库中相应的文章:
2772858 在发布 SQL Server 2012 Service Pack 1 之后发布的 SQL Server 2012 版本
状态
Microsoft 已经确认这是一个列于“适用范围”部分的 Microsoft 产品问题。